The correct anchor text is very important when linking internally on your website. If the text you use is generic, like "click here," you are missing out on a great opportunity to optimize your site a little more. Using keywords as your anchor text is another way to earn brownie points with search engine spiders.

Be sure to use very descriptive title tags so that search engines will comprehend your site content easily. Search engines usually will not show content past 60 characters. After 60 characters, search engines also weigh terms less highly.

Make your site easier for search engine spiders to navigate by avoiding dynamic URLs whenever possible. Incorporate a keyword into a naturally flowing URL for best results.

After you carefully determine which key-phrases you will "sprinkle" throughout your website, make sure to include them in your web page title. Create an interesting and trendy title, because it will be the first glimpse of your website that users from search engines will get. By having a more generic word in the title, searchers who aren't aware of your company's name will still visit your website to find what they are looking for.
